﻿/* About page styles extracted from about.blade.php + section/about/* */

/* === from about.blade.php === */
[data-aos] {
        transition-property: transform, opacity;
    }

    .has-hover .img-inner img,
    .item-giaychungnhan img,
    .item-danhhieu img {
        transition: transform 0.45s ease, filter 0.35s ease;
        will-change: transform;
    }

    .has-hover:hover .img-inner img,
    .item-giaychungnhan:hover img,
    .item-danhhieu:hover img {
        transform: scale(1.04);
        filter: saturate(1.05);
    }

    .swiper-mangluoi-desc .mangluoi-desc-title {
        margin: 0 0 12px;
        font-size: 1.1rem;
        font-weight: 700;
    }

    .swiper-mangluoi-desc .content {
        display: block;
    }

    #swiper-wrapper-51f7bacda1bcb0fa,
    .swiper-giaychungnhan .swiper-wrapper[id^="swiper-wrapper-"] {
        justify-content: flex-start !important;
        margin-left: 0 !important;
    }

    #section_775191375 [data-aos],
    #section_1894843329 [data-aos],
    #section_775191375 .aos-init,
    #section_775191375 .aos-animate,
    #section_1894843329 .aos-init,
    #section_1894843329 .aos-animate {
        opacity: 1 !important;
        transform: none !important;
        animation: none !important;
        transition: none !important;
    }

/* === from section/about/achievements.blade.php === */
#gap-1667672966 {
  padding-top: 60px;
}

#section_1286362978 {
  padding-top: 30px;
  padding-bottom: 30px;
}

/* === from section/about/certificates.blade.php === */
#gap-578854835 {
  padding-top: 60px;
}

#section_732822038 {
  padding-top: 30px;
  padding-bottom: 30px;
}

/* === from section/about/ecosystem.blade.php === */
#image_1882583138 {
  width: 100%;
}

#section_1409475402 {
  padding-top: 30px;
  padding-bottom: 30px;
}

/* === from section/about/milestones-desktop.blade.php === */
#image_151690212 {
  width: 100%;
}

#stack-3428903584 > * {
  --stack-gap: 0rem;
}

#image_167691096 {
  width: 100%;
}

#stack-295278753 > * {
  --stack-gap: 0rem;
}

#image_1718235124 {
  width: 100%;
}

#stack-2874559261 > * {
  --stack-gap: 0rem;
}

#image_106853879 {
  width: 100%;
}

#stack-3530305198 > * {
  --stack-gap: 0rem;
}

#image_558868536 {
  width: 100%;
}

#stack-95134133 > * {
  --stack-gap: 0rem;
}

#image_1484297202 {
  width: 100%;
}

#stack-3161331359 > * {
  --stack-gap: 0rem;
}

#image_1100121857 {
  width: 100%;
}

#stack-1893919359 > * {
  --stack-gap: 0rem;
}

#image_1456988572 {
  width: 100%;
}

#stack-631119783 > * {
  --stack-gap: 0rem;
}

#image_754462939 {
  width: 100%;
}

#stack-343587080 > * {
  --stack-gap: 0rem;
}

#image_729465514 {
  width: 100%;
}

#stack-2243295932 > * {
  --stack-gap: 0rem;
}

#image_550141247 {
  width: 100%;
}

#stack-2412520679 > * {
  --stack-gap: 0rem;
}

#image_94295774 {
  width: 100%;
}

#stack-2912316480 > * {
  --stack-gap: 0rem;
}

#image_494766351 {
  width: 100%;
}

#stack-2555075689 > * {
  --stack-gap: 0rem;
}

#image_761161361 {
  width: 100%;
}

#stack-2788190821 > * {
  --stack-gap: 0rem;
}

#image_173113519 {
  width: 100%;
}

#stack-2659561676 > * {
  --stack-gap: 0rem;
}

#image_173728694 {
  width: 100%;
}

#stack-1091917416 > * {
  --stack-gap: 0rem;
}

#image_1627731423 {
  width: 100%;
}

#stack-1016508889 > * {
  --stack-gap: 0rem;
}

#section_775191375 {
  padding-top: 30px;
  padding-bottom: 30px;
  margin-bottom: 40px;
}

/* === from section/about/milestones-mobile.blade.php === */
#image_849179101 {
  width: 100%;
}

#text-2760983936 {
  font-size: 1rem;
  text-align: left;
}

#stack-2761298108 > * {
  --stack-gap: 0rem;
}

#image_1738856860 {
  width: 100%;
}

#stack-4107336675 > * {
  --stack-gap: 0rem;
}

#image_1239916015 {
  width: 100%;
}
@media (min-width:550px) {
  #image_1239916015 {
    width: 100%;
  }
}

#stack-224875567 > * {
  --stack-gap: 0rem;
}

#image_1878231793 {
  width: 100%;
}

#stack-2683692209 > * {
  --stack-gap: 0rem;
}

#image_1898658115 {
  width: 100%;
}

#stack-2411621521 > * {
  --stack-gap: 0rem;
}

#image_955116329 {
  width: 100%;
}

#stack-460913969 > * {
  --stack-gap: 0rem;
}

#image_612925672 {
  width: 100%;
}

#stack-290268928 > * {
  --stack-gap: 0rem;
}

#image_430122410 {
  width: 100%;
}

#stack-3646294921 > * {
  --stack-gap: 0rem;
}

#image_1437411738 {
  width: 100%;
}

#stack-1609888691 > * {
  --stack-gap: 0rem;
}

#image_134431397 {
  width: 100%;
}

#stack-3125826024 > * {
  --stack-gap: 0rem;
}

#image_1887822446 {
  width: 100%;
}

#stack-4165062893 > * {
  --stack-gap: 0rem;
}

#image_278277477 {
  width: 100%;
}

#stack-855717316 > * {
  --stack-gap: 0rem;
}

#image_549895130 {
  width: 100%;
}

#stack-3436298176 > * {
  --stack-gap: 0rem;
}

#image_1992900626 {
  width: 100%;
}

#stack-2017146824 > * {
  --stack-gap: 0rem;
}

#image_166464632 {
  width: 100%;
}

#stack-2002614734 > * {
  --stack-gap: 0rem;
}

#image_1162215991 {
  width: 100%;
}

#stack-3288608301 > * {
  --stack-gap: 0rem;
}

#section_1894843329 {
  padding-top: 30px;
  padding-bottom: 30px;
}

/* === from section/about/office-network.blade.php === */
#text-3722048770 {
  font-size: 1.85rem;
}

@media (min-width: 850px) {
  #section_1068821901 .swiper-mangluoi-container {
    max-width: 1260px;
    margin-left: auto;
    margin-right: auto;
    padding-left: 15px;
    padding-right: 15px;
    justify-content: flex-start !important;
    align-items: flex-start !important;
  }

  #section_1068821901 .swiper-mangluoi {
    margin-left: 0 !important;
    margin-right: 0 !important;
  }

  #section_1068821901 .swiper-mangluoi.swiper-initialized .swiper-slide {
    justify-content: flex-start !important;
  }

  #section_1068821901 .swiper-mangluoi .swiper-wrapper {
    align-items: flex-start;
  }
}

#section_1068821901 {
  padding-top: 30px;
  padding-bottom: 30px;
}

/* === from section/about/overview.blade.php === */
#col-1123138495 > .col-inner {
  padding: 5% 5% 5% 5%;
  max-width: 520px;
}

#image_1265459707 {
  width: 100%;
}

#section_1001540857 {
  padding-top: 30px;
  padding-bottom: 30px;
}

/* === from section/about/vision-mission.blade.php === */
#image_72323487 {
  width: 100%;
}

#image_2093146869 {
  width: 100%;
}

#image_82139459 {
  width: 100%;
}

#section_444187231 {
  padding-top: 30px;
  padding-bottom: 30px;
}

